show of hands
a raising of hands, as in voting or volunteering
noun: an indication of approval, disapproval, volunteering, etc., on the part of a group of persons, usually made by each assenting person raising his or her hand
noun: the raising of hands to indicate voting for or against a proposition
phrase: If a question is decided by a show of hands, people vote on it by raising their hands to indicate whether they vote yes or no.
